Accessible Shower Construction in Bradenton, FL
Accessible shower construction services focus on designing and building showers that prioritize safety, comfort, and ease of use for individuals with mobility challenges or special needs. These projects often involve installing features such as low-threshold ent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able showerheads to create a functional space that accommodates various accessibility requirements. Property owners typically seek these services when planning renovations to improve safety or when adapting existing bathrooms to better serve residents with limited mobility, aging in place, or disabilities.
Before requesting accessible shower constru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of modifications needed, the types of features available, and how these changes can enhance safety and usability. It’s important to consider the existing bathroom layout, plumbing requirements, and any specific accessibility standards or preferences. Clear communication about desired features and budget expectations can help ensure the project aligns with individual needs and results in a safe, comfortable shower space.

Accessible Shower Construction Questions
What types of accessible showers are available? There are various options including walk-in showers, curbless designs, and shower seats to accommodate different needs and preferences.
Can accessible shower construction be added to existing bathrooms? Yes, accessible features can often be integrated into existing shower areas to improve safety and accessibility.
What features are commonly included in accessible showers? Features such as grab bars, non-slip flooring, handheld showerheads, and seating are typically incorporated for safety and convenience.
Is accessible shower construction suitable for all property types? Accessible shower solutions can be customized to fit a variety of bathroom sizes and layouts, making them suitable for many property types.
